About rich mix concrete

Concrete is a vital construction material that offers durability, strength, and versatility. A rich mix of concrete refers to a concrete mix that has a higher cement content than the standard concrete mix. The higher cement content results in a stronger and more durable concrete ideal for various construction applications.

What is a rich mix of concrete?

It is a rich mix of concrete that offers enhanced strength and durability, making it suitable for heavy-duty applications. In a typical mix, the ratio of cement to sand to aggregate is usually 1:2:3. However, in a rich mix, the proportion of cement to sand to aggregate is increased, such as 1:1.5:2.5. This increased cement content provides a higher strength of concrete. The key to a successful rich concrete mix lies in the precise proportion of materials and thorough mixing. It is crucial to follow the specific guidelines for mixing and placing a rich mix of concrete to ensure the desired strength and durability are achieved.

Advantages of a rich mix of concrete

Its advantages are numerous. A rich mix of concrete offers several advantages in various construction scenarios. First and foremost, its enhanced strength makes it ideal for structural elements that require high load-bearing capacity, such as foundations, columns, and beams. The increased durability of the richer mix of concrete significantly contributes to its ability to withstand harsh environmental conditions, making it suitable for projects in challenging environments. Additionally, the reduced permeability of the rich mix ensures better resistance to water and chemical penetration, enhancing its longevity. The use of a rich mix can contribute to faster construction schedules, as it allows for thinner structural elements without compromising strength, reducing the overall weight of the structure, and requiring less material. The enhanced workability of the rich mix leads to smoother finishes, making it an attractive choice for architectural elements. The advantages of a rich mix of concrete make it a valuable option for projects where strength, durability, and performance are paramount.

Applications of a rich mix of concrete

The applications of a rich mix of concrete are widespread, ranging from heavy industrial projects to intricate architectural designs. In the construction of high-rise buildings, bridges, dams, and other critical infrastructure projects, a rich mix of concrete is often used in the construction of structural elements such as columns, beams, and foundations. In these applications, the enhanced strength and durability of the rich mix are essential for ensuring the longevity and safety of the structure. Architectural projects that demand a smooth finish may benefit from the workability and aesthetic appeal of a rich mix of concrete. It is also employed in the construction of pavements, roads, and runways, as its ability to withstand heavy traffic and harsh weather conditions is crucial. In the industrial sector, a rich mix is utilized to create floors in warehouses, manufacturing plants, and storage facilities, where its durability and resistance to abrasion are advantageous. These applications demonstrate the diverse uses of a rich mix of concrete in the construction industry, highlighting its importance in creating robust and long-lasting structures.
